首页 > 编程语言 >Python学习笔记--文件的相关操作

Python学习笔记--文件的相关操作

时间:2022-12-21 16:25:50浏览次数:38  
标签:文件 读取 Python 笔记 -- 操作 txt 实现

文件的读取操作

读操作

实现:

read()--读完
read(10)--读取10个字节
readline()--将所有行并到一行输出
readlines()--一次读取一行

文件的关闭:

实现:

上面的这种用法,使用完成之后,会自动关闭文件

案例:

实现:

写操作

实现:

追加写操作

基本同写入操作一致

实现:

综合案例:

实现:(鉴于上述案例的内容较多,我直接实现文件内容复制--将word.txt内容复制到word2.txt文件中)

标签:文件,读取,Python,笔记,--,操作,txt,实现
From: https://www.cnblogs.com/liuzijin/p/16994874.html

相关文章

  • mysql federated引擎构建MySQL分布式数据库
    使用mysql federated 引擎构建 MySQL 分布式数据库访问层前言:随着应用复杂度的增加,数据库不断细化切分,导致应用程序中数据库应用就得复杂,凌乱。绝大部分程序人员可能......
  • PVE常用命令
    1.查看集群下的节点信息root@pve63-node172:~#pvecmnodesMembershipinformation----------------------NodeidVotesName11pve63-node172(local)21pve63......
  • Typora快捷键-官方版
    Typora快捷键常用快捷键文件功能Hotkey(Windows/Linux)热键(macOS)新增功能Ctrl+NCommand+N新窗口Ctrl+Shift+NCommand+Shift+N新标签页......
  • JAVA实现邮件发送
    一、邮件服务器与传输协议要在网络上实现邮件功能,必须要有专门的邮件服务器。这些邮件服务器类似于现实生活中的邮局,它主要负责接收用户投递过来的邮件,并把邮件投递到邮......
  • emacs config
    ..IuseEmacsinconsole.The linum-mode displaysthelinenumbersjustwell.However,intheconsole,thereisnospacebetweenthelinenumbersandthete......
  • C++函数参数传递的三种方式之 指针传递(地址传递)
    前景提示:因为目前是对C#比较熟悉,而C++基础堪忧,在学习CGAL时,发现CGAL封装的函数体的参数中动不动就出现'&'、'*'这两个字符,接而疑惑于心中油然而生。//函数定义conv......
  • openssl jni nginx证书私钥有效性校验
     1、安装opensslwgethttps://www.openssl.org/source/openssl-1.1.1b.tar.gz./config--prefix=/usr/local/openssl --shared--shared为添加动态库,生成libssl.so,默......
  • ESX与ESXi区别
    VMwareESXi 与ESX 产品之比较VMwarevSphere5.0 以后版本,所有底层虚拟化产品都改为ESXi产品,本文主要比较了ESXi与ESX的各自特点,以便对大家是否要把现有的ESX升级......
  • Markdown文字颜色、高亮、字体字号设置
    文字颜色写法<fontcolor=#0099ff>color#0099ff</font><fontcolor=red>红色</font>color#0099ff红色字体字号默认字体<fontface="黑体">黑体</font><fontfa......
  • [React] State and Callbacks Don’t Mix Well in React
    //Doesn'tworkimportReactfrom'react'import{saveInfo}from'./api'exportdefaultfunctionApp(){const[count,setCount]=React.useState(0)......